What Exactly is Caldo Pollo Telegram?

When someone talks about "caldo pollo telegram," they are typically referring to a group or channel on the Telegram messaging application where people come together because of a shared interest in caldo de pollo. It's not just about one specific recipe, though that is a big part of it. Instead, it is about the broader culture, the comfort, and the various ways this beloved dish is made and enjoyed across different places. So, it's almost like a digital potluck, if you will, where everyone brings their own version of something wonderful to share.

Finding the Right Channels

The most common way to find these groups is through word-of-mouth, or by searching within Telegram itself. You can often use keywords like "caldo pollo," "chicken soup," or "recipes" in the Telegram search bar. Sometimes, people will share links to these groups on other social media platforms or food blogs. It’s a bit like a treasure hunt, but usually a rewarding one. How do I find specific interest groups on Telegram?

You can find specific interest groups on Telegram by using the app's search bar with relevant keywords, like "caldo pollo" or "chicken soup recipes." Sometimes, people share direct links to groups on social media, forums, or food blogs. There are also websites that list Telegram groups by category, which can be a good starting point.
